WASHINGTON, June 16, 2022 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— Farah K. Ahmed, President and CEO of the Fragrance Creators Association, released the following statement after the House passed and President Biden endorsed the ‘Ocean Shipping Reform Act, S. 3580:
“Fragrance Creators applauds the final passage and Presidential signing of the Ocean Shipping Reform Act (OSRA). We echo President Biden feelings that this bill is one piece of a puzzle to combat rising costs and inflation in the United States and were thrilled to see his swift signing on the bill making it law. We thank our more than 60 diverse member companies for enabling fragrance creators to play an active and integral role in advancing this legislation, directly engaging more than 50 congressional offices and indirectly targeting many more through through widely circulated letters.
“As the initiator of the legislation, together with our allied trades, we are pleased to play an active role in advancing this important legislation designed to address the shipping supply chain challenges that ultimately impact on consumers in the form of higher prices and emptying shelves.
“Fragrance is a critical input into a myriad of end products, including personal care, cleaning and sanitizing, and the delay in fragrance supply has a ripple effect on the value chain. why Fragrance Creators is fully committed to supporting supplier diversity, a strong, adaptable and resilient supply chain, and legislation such as OSRA.
“The Merchant Shipping Act was last amended over 20 years ago. The industry has changed significantly since that last update and because of this we are facing long term systemic issues. date of supply chain and port disruption and congestion. While they existed before 2020, the COVID-19 pandemic has only amplified these challenges. OSRA is helping to address both the issues long-standing and those exacerbated by the COVID-19 pandemic by enhancing the role of the Federal Maritime Commission to address practices such as unreasonable demurrage and other charges, to combat other unreasonable business practices, and Moreover.”

Fragrance Creators Association is the primary fragrance trade association representing the majority of fragrance manufacturing in North America. We also represent fragrance-related interests throughout the value chain. The more than 60 member companies of Fragrance Creators are diverse, including large, medium and small companies that create, manufacture and use fragrances and fragrances for home care, personal care, home design, fragrances purposes and industrial and institutional products. , as well as those supplying fragrance ingredients, including natural extracts and other raw materials used in perfumery and fragrance blends. Fragrance Creators created and administers the Congressional Fragrance Caucus, ensuring ongoing dialogue with members of Congress and staff. We actively participate in IFRA and have a designated representative on the IFRA Board of Directors to ensure that association members are represented in global discussions and that the North American perspective is considered in positions. and global fragrance policies.
